DX-G: a high-performance, modular X-ray cassette digitisation system
The AGFA DX-G is a CR digitisation system designed to convert latent images on phosphor plates into highly accurate digital data. Featuring fine-beam laser scanning technology, the DX-G guarantees high resolution and optimal image fidelity, which is essential for reliable radiological diagnosis.
This digitiser is designed for demanding hospital environments. It accepts up to five cassettes simultaneously, enabling continuous workflow management without interruption. Cassettes are automatically fed, digitised and ejected, freeing operators from repetitive manual tasks. Each image is processed, erased and reinserted into its cassette, ready for re-exposure.
The DX-G integrates seamlessly with an NX workstation via a dedicated Ethernet connection, where images are identified, processed and archived. It also allows images to be rerouted to other stations in the event of unavailability or failure, ensuring continuity of service. In the event of a loss of connection, the system temporarily stores the images and resumes sending them once the link is restored.
Image quality is based on needle plate technology, which limits the diffusion of the light signal and thus increases the signal-to-noise ratio. The system is also equipped with a plate erasure mechanism after digitisation and offers a re-erasure mode to prevent ghost images.
Designed for stationary or mobile use, the DX-G is robust and complies with international electrical safety and electromagnetic compatibility standards.
Maintenance is facilitated by quick access to essential components, such as the air filter and optical unit, and simple cleaning procedures that can be carried out by the user.
